Durham v Derbyshire
National Westminster Bank Trophy 1994 (2nd Round)
VenueFeethams Cricket Ground, Darlington on 6th, 7th July 1994 (60-over match)
Balls per over6
TossDerbyshire won the toss and decided to field
ResultDerbyshire won by 4 wickets
UmpiresVA Holder, KJ Lyons
ScorersB Hunt (Durham), SW Tacey (Derbyshire)
Close of play day 1Derbyshire 119/2 (Adams 26*, O'Gorman 43*; 30.1 overs)
Man of the MatchTJG O'Gorman

Notes
--> The match was scheduled for one day but extended to two.
--> TJG O'Gorman passed his previous highest ListA Matches score of 69
--> PAJ DeFreitas reached 350 wickets in ListA Matches when he dismissed , his 1st wicket in the Durham innings

Source: Durham CCC scorebook with thanks to Brian Hunt
Rain stopped play at 5.30pm on the first day and so the match continued into a second.
